Can I request a review of my criminal record if the records are incorrect or outdated?

Yes, if you believe your court records are incorrect or out of date, you can request a review. You must contact the National Civil Police (PNC) and submit a request to correct or update the records. Provide all necessary documentation and evidence to support your request. The PNC will conduct an investigation and, if it is determined that the records are incorrect or outdated, will proceed to correct them.

What is the process for applying for a K-1 Visa for Mexican fiancés who plan to marry US citizens in the United States?

The K-1 Visa, known as the Fiancé Visa, is an option for Mexicans who plan to marry American citizens in the United States. The process generally involves the following: 1. K-1 Visa Application: The U.S. citizen files a K-1 Visa petition on behalf of his or her Mexican fiancé(e) with the U.S. Citizenship and Immigration Services. USA (USCIS). 2. Approval of the petition: After approval of the petition, the Mexican fiancé(e) must complete a visa application process at the United States Consulate in Mexico, which includes a consular interview and presentation of documentation to demonstrate the relationship and intention to marry. 3. Approved K-1 Visa: If the K-1 Visa is approved, the fiancé(e) may travel to the United States and must marry the U.S. citizen within 90 days of arrival. After marriage, the fiancé(e) can apply for adjustment of status to obtain permanent residency. It is important to follow the specific procedures and requirements for the K-1 Visa and seek legal advice if necessary.
